Plast Project "Jolly" Cylinder Valves, diameter 25 mm - 50 pieces

Jolly" valve Diam. 25 super compact cylinder valve of economic type, composed by 2 pieces and 2 gaskets OR. Although small in size, it nevertheless maintains a 9 mm passage hole, which guarantees minimum pressure drops in the points of the system where it is installed.   Applications Kit n°50 "Jolly" cylinder valves diam.25: Great versatility, especially in secondary irrigation lines of short and medium length, or in drip lines. Particularly suitable for irrigation systems with fertigation. Suitable for PE PN4 polyethylene pipe   Materials used Kit n°50 "Jolly" cylinder valves diam.25: Valve entirely made of polypropylene, reinforced with glass fibers, and stabilized against UV. Acer Palmatum 'Inaba Shidare' (Japanese Maple 'Inaba Shidare') - Half-Standard

'Inaba Shidare' Group has a low, spreading habit and specimens are often multi-stemmed. The leaves are so dissected as to appear almost shredded. Although green through the spring and summer they show good autumn colour. Red flowers are a discrete attraction in spring. These develop into winged fruit, typical of the genus. The origin of these plants is in the Far East, in particular Japan, Korea and China. Moist but well drained soil is recommended along with clay and loam additions. This plant has a high hardiness rating of H6 making it perfect for the UK climate. Only shelter in an extreme cold snap. It is affected by potential diseases and pests so take care when looking after this plant. The maximum height it can grow is between 1.5 m – 2.5 m (4.9 ft – 8.2 ft) and the maximum width is between 1.5 m – 2.5 m (4.9 ft – 8.2 ft). Peony (Paeonia Itoh) Bartzella

An intersectional hybrid between a tree peony and a herbaceous peony forming a plant about 80cm high with a woody base. It has deeply divided, mid-green leaves with pointed segments, and large, scented, semi-double to double, lemon-yellow flowers in early to mid-summer. An adult plant can produce up to 50 flowers. "Bartzella" won the gold medal for the best variety in 1986. Citrus x Mitis (Calamondin Orange) – Espalier

Calamansi (Citrus microcarpa,× Citrofortunella microcarpa or × Citrofortunella mitis), also known as calamondin or Philippine lime, is an economically important citrus hybrid predominantly cultivated in the Philippines. It is native to the Philippines and surrounding areas in southern China, Taiwan, Borneo, and Sulawesi. Calamansi is ubiquitous in traditional Filipino cuisine. It is used in various condiments, beverages, dishes, marinades, and preserves. Calamansi is also used as an ingredient in the cuisines of Malaysia and Indonesia. Calamansi is a citrofortunella, a hybrid between kumquat (formerly considered as belonging to a separate genus Fortunella) and another species of Citrus (in this case probably the mandarin orange). This plant needs plenty of natural sunlight although it has a low hardiness rating of H3 making it essential to cover your plant during the winter time. Try to give this plant a once year trim and follow the guidelines of pruning group 1 for further ideas. The plant can suffer from potential pest problems although is usually disease free. The plant can growth to a final width between 30 cm – 50 cm (0.9 ft – 1.6 ft) and a final height of 50 – 70 cm (1.6 ft – 2.3 ft). Phoenix Dactylifera (Date Palm)

Phoenix Dactylifera, commonly known as the Date Palm, is a majestic and iconic tree renowned for its sweet, nutritious fruit and graceful appearance. Native to the Middle East and North Africa, this palm species has been cultivated for thousands of years for its valuable fruit and versatile uses. In a garden, the Date Palm serves not only as a source of delicious dates but also as an ornamental focal point, adding a tropical and exotic touch to the landscape. With its tall, slender trunk topped by a crown of gracefully arching fronds, the date palm exudes elegance and beauty.
